Webtransmission system operator (TSO): an organisation which is responsible for the transport of energy at national or regional level using fixed infrastructure. distribution system operator (DSO): an organisation responsible for providing and operating low, medium and high voltage networks for regional distribution of electricity as well as for supply of lower-level … WebDec 6, 2024 · The TSO-DSO coordination in the Clean Energy Package Electricity Directive, Article 32(1) 10. ... coordination schemes • A coordination scheme is defined as “the relation between TSO and DSO, defining the roles and responsibilities of each system operator, when procuring and using system services…” (Gerard et al., 2024).” WebThe DSO organizes a local market while respecting an exchange power schedule agreed with the TSO, while the TSO has no access to the resources connected to the distribution grid.
